====== Bitcoin Podlights ======

What Bitcoin Did with Peter McCormack - Why We Shouldnโ€™t Trust BlackRock with Whitney Webb & Mark Goodwin

- ๐ŸŒ The potential development of a new global financial system led by entities like Blackrock, aiming to minimize risk for large asset managers while expanding their control and ownership.

- ๐ŸŽ™๏ธ The popularity and impact of a previous episode featuring Whitney Webb on the "What Bitcoin Did" podcast.

- ๐Ÿค The collaboration between Whitney Webb and Mark Goodwin on recent articles, including one focused on Blackrock's plans for a "fractionalized world."

- ๐Ÿ’ผ Larry Fink's background, the role of ETFs, the desire to tokenize various assets, and partisan politics in the U.S.

- ๐Ÿช™ Discussions around the tokenization of assets, including Bitcoin, as a means for asset storage and the implications for the financial sector.

- ๐Ÿ›๏ธ The relationship between partisan politics, the "Uni-party" control in the U.S., and the broader implications for financial and political systems.

- ๐ŸŒฟ The role of sustainable development policies, global carbon markets, and the push for a digital financial governance system.

- ๐Ÿฆ The connection between private sector initiatives and the perpetuation of the debt slavery model historically used by multilateral development banks.

- ๐Ÿ“ˆ The involvement of Wall Street giants and figures like Larry Fink in shaping a new financial paradigm and the risks associated with their expansive control.

- ๐Ÿ“ฐ The shifting landscape of independent media and the potential manipulation of public opinion by influential figures and funding sources.

- ๐Ÿ”„ The dynamic between public and private sector interests and the efforts to sway public perception towards acceptance of digital IDs and programmable money.

- ๐Ÿ”— The importance of critical thinking, media literacy, and independent research in the age of widespread information manipulation and psychological operations.

- ๐Ÿ“ข The need for the Bitcoin community to reflect on the direction of the cryptocurrency and its potential co-option by Wall Street for commoditization rather than as a tool for financial sovereignty.

====== Bitcoin Podlights ======

- โšฝ๏ธ Botev Plovdiv, Bulgaria's oldest football club, has adopted Bitcoin, drawing international attention and mixed reactions from fans.

- ๐ŸŒ The club's move aligns with a growing trend of Bitcoin adoption in various sectors, similar to El Salvador's national cryptocurrency initiative and MicroStrategy's investment strategy.

- ๐Ÿค George Monov, a local expert on Bitcoin, spearheads the club's cryptocurrency integration, promoting the significance of Bitcoin for the community.

- ๐Ÿ“š Efforts by individuals like George to translate key Bitcoin literature into Bulgarian aim to increase local understanding and adoption.

- ๐Ÿ“ˆ The club's adoption of Bitcoin is seen as a strategic move to gain a first-mover advantage in the financial technology space.

- ๐Ÿ•ต๏ธโ€โ™‚๏ธ Skepticism around the adoption stems from Bulgaria's history with cryptocurrency scams, such as the notorious OneCoin scheme.

- ๐ŸŒ Botev Plovdiv is not only adopting Bitcoin but also exploring Nostr, a decentralized communication technology, to potentially enhance fan engagement and avoid censorship issues.

- ๐ŸŸ๏ธ The club hosts Bitcoin meetups before home games to educate fans, inspired by similar initiatives by other Bitcoin-friendly football clubs.

- ๐Ÿ›๏ธ Bitcoin is accepted in the club's fan shop for merchandise purchases, demonstrating practical use cases within the football community.

- ๐Ÿš€ While there are challenges and resistance from some fans, the overall sentiment towards Bitcoin adoption at Botev Plovdiv is optimistic, with many seeing it as an innovative step forward.

- ๐ŸŽค The vidoe highlights the cultural and social impact of combining Bitcoin with sports, as well as the potential for such initiatives to change mindsets and promote financial technology.

====== Bitcoin Podlights ======

- ๐ŸŒ Global Risk Management: Samson Mow emphasized the importance of constantly reassessing risk in the current macroeconomic climate, where traditional assets like stocks are behaving unpredictably and national debts are soaring. He highlighted the need to update risk assessments rather than relying on outdated perceptions of assets like Bitcoin.

- ๐Ÿ“ˆ Bitcoin ETFs and Mainstream Acceptance: The conversation touched on the impact of Bitcoin ETFs on the asset's legitimacy, with Mow pointing out that entities like BlackRock offering a Bitcoin ETF simplifies discussions with risk managers and central banks about Bitcoin strategies.

- ๐ŸŽ™๏ธ Podcast Introduction: Walker introduced the Bitcoin podcast episode, noting the current Bitcoin block height and value, and encouraged listeners to subscribe and consider using Fountain FM to support podcasters with Bitcoin.

- ๐Ÿค Samson Mow's Journey to Bitcoin: Mow, with a background in game development, shared his initial fascination with Bitcoin's decentralized nature and how it operates without centralized management. His career evolved from game development to engaging with nation-states on Bitcoin adoption.

- ๐ŸŒ Nation-State Bitcoin Adoption: The discussion moved to nation-state adoption of Bitcoin, with Mow's company, Jan. Three, working to support both government-level engagements and grassroots initiatives with non-custodial wallets like Aqua.

- ๐Ÿ› ๏ธ Jan. Three and Bitcoin Technology: Mow described Jan. Three's mission to accelerate Bitcoin adoption and how they provide technological solutions and financial services to countries transitioning to a Bitcoin standard. This includes educating governments and offering Bitcoin wallets that can be white-labeled for country-specific use.

- ๐Ÿ›๏ธ Advocacy for Bitcoin Strategy: Mow discussed his approach to advocating for Bitcoin strategy with national leaders, tailoring the conversation to each country's unique situation and energy resources to demonstrate Bitcoin's potential benefits.

- ๐Ÿ“‰ Bitcoin as a Legitimate Asset Class: The conversation highlighted how Bitcoin's increasing recognition as an asset class, exemplified by ETF approvals, is changing the dialogue around Bitcoin and challenging misconceptions about its riskiness.

- ๐Ÿ“Š Bitcoin's Role in Politics: Walker and Mow talked about Bitcoin entering political discourse, with politicians like RFK Jr. accepting Bitcoin donations, reflecting a shift in narrative and the potential for Bitcoin to shape the political landscape.

- ๐ŸŒ Global Financial Dynamics: Mow shared insights on the possibility of nations like Argentina adopting Bitcoin in unique ways, independent of the model used by El Salvador, and how this could disrupt the global financial system.

- โšก Bitcoin Mining and Sovereign Nations: The discussion included the rise in Bitcoin's hash rate, speculated to be influenced by sovereign mining, and the potential for countries like Colombia and Suriname to begin mining Bitcoin.

- ๐Ÿ”ฎ Predictions for Bitcoin's Price: Mow shared his prediction of a rapid increase in Bitcoin's price to $1 million, which he refers to as the "Omega Candle," and the factors he believes will contribute to this surge, including ETF demand and the upcoming Bitcoin halving.

- ๐ŸŒ China's Relationship with Bitcoin: The conversation concluded with speculation about China's potential shift in stance towards Bitcoin, considering the economic challenges the country faces and its significant energy infrastructure.

====== Bitcoin Podlights ======

Coin Stories: Luke Gromen & Preston Pysh: Macro + Bitcoin Outlook and How to Invest in 2023

- ๐ŸŒ Discussion on the current state of macro and markets, highlighting the balance of payments and funding problems, rising energy and commodity issues, and the dilemma of raising interest rates amidst a potential debt spiral.

- ๐Ÿฆ Conversation about the Fed's rate hikes, the surprising resilience of the financial system thus far, and potential future consequences of the aggressive rate increases.

- ๐Ÿ’ต Insights into the declining dollar, liquidity injections, and how these factors influence the global economy and financial markets.

- ๐Ÿค” Debate on the CPI (Consumer Price Index) adjustments and the potential manipulation of inflation data for policy purposes.

- ๐Ÿ“ˆ Analysis of the labor market's strength and underlying factors such as disability rates and mortality impacting workforce numbers, juxtaposed with Powell's narrative.

- ๐Ÿ”„ Discussion of the "debt doom loop," where debt servicing costs surpass economic growth and government receipts, forcing either cuts in spending or monetization of debt.

- ๐Ÿ›  Mention of the Exchange Stabilization Fund (ESF) as a tool for market manipulation and liquidity injection with little oversight.

- ๐Ÿ“‰ Perspectives on investing strategies for different age groups in the current volatile macro environment, emphasizing balance, low leverage, and investment in self.

- โš–๏ธ The role of gold as a reserve asset and the possibility of a gold re-valuation event, especially as central banks have been increasing gold reserves.

- ๐Ÿ’ฐ Final thoughts on the importance of understanding money and its manipulation, adjusting to the macroeconomic environment, and focusing on Bitcoin and other scarce assets.

- ๐Ÿ“Š General sentiment that the fiscal and monetary issues are a recurring human nature cycle, with a call to acknowledge the systemic problems and adjust accordingly.
